In 2017, the outstanding physicist Stephen Hawking predicted that by 2600, Earth would turn into a "fireball" due to overpopulation and depletion of natural resources. He presented this grim forecast at the Tencent WE summit in Beijing, emphasizing that the pace of population growth and consumption would lead to catastrophe.
The scientist insisted that humanity must urgently seek an alternative - leave Earth and establish colonies in space. He considered this the only chance to save civilization.
In 2016, Hawking supported the ambitious Breakthrough Starshot project - launching thousands of mini-probes to nearby stars in search of habitable worlds. These probes are planned to be accelerated to 15,000 km/s.
